Three individual years of high global average temperatures will be enough for scientists to conclude the 1.5掳C climate goal is lost, a new analysis reveals.
In the 2015 Paris Agreement, almost every nation in the world signed up to an international treaty promising to limit any rise in global average temperatures to 鈥渨ell below鈥 2掳C above pre-industrial levels, and to aim for just 1.5掳C of warming.
